Hydrologic automatic monitoring stations (HAMS) are designed to monitor and record water levels, flow rates, and other important water quality parameters in a variety of water bodies, including rivers, lakes, and streams. These stations play a crucial role in ensuring the health and safety of our water resources, as well as providing valuable data for environmental studies and management.

When it comes to the construction of HAMS, there are several key standards and guidelines that must be followed to ensure the accuracy, reliability, and longevity of the station. These standards are typically established by federal, state, or local government agencies, and may vary depending on the specific location and needs of the station.

One of the most important aspects of HAMS construction is the selection of the station site. The site should be chosen based on several factors, including the type of water body to be monitored, the desired accuracy of measurement, and the ease of access for maintenance and repairs. Additionally, the site should be protected from natural or human-made disturbances that could affect the accuracy of the measurements.

Another crucial aspect of HAMS construction is the design of the station structure. The structure should be designed to withstand the forces of nature, such as wind, rain, and waves, while also providing a stable platform for the monitoring equipment. This may require the use of strong materials like steel or concrete, as well as careful consideration of the station’s shape and size.

Once the site and structure have been selected and designed, the next step is to install the monitoring equipment. This equipment may include water level sensors, flow rate meters, and water quality analyzers. It is essential that these devices are properly calibrated and maintained to ensure their accuracy and reliability. Additionally, the equipment should be designed to withstand the harsh conditions found in many water bodies.

Finally, once the HAMS has been constructed and equipped, it is important to establish a monitoring program to ensure its continued operation and data collection. This program should include regular inspections and maintenance visits, as well as data collection and analysis to ensure the health of our water resources.
